A Port Coquitlam resident whose car was among dozens that were keyed last week in the PoCo West Coast Express parking lot has been left wondering how anyone could be so mean-spirited.

Steve Bradley said he discovered on Nov. 4 that both sides of his "pride and joy" were keyed the day before while he was parked. He said a friend had the same done to his car, as did a fellow train passenger with whom he regularly sits.

"I'm very fortunate, the $300 deductible doesn't bother me," Bradley said. "But Christmas is getting closer and closer, a lot of people can't afford this. Why would you do this to people?"

Coquitlam RCMP said there may have been up to 50 car keying reports that came in and the community police office was looking into it.
